Multi Level Deck Installation in Fairfield County, CT
Multi-level deck installation services provide homeowners with the opportunity to create functional outdoor living spaces that feature multiple tiers or levels. These projects often involve designing and building decks that incorporate different heights, allowing for distinct areas such as dining spaces, lounging zones, or garden views. Property owners typically request multi-level decks to maximize yard space, improve aesthetic appeal, or accommodate uneven terrain, making outdoor areas more versatile and visually interesting.
Before requesting a multi-level deck installation,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the project, including design options, materials used, and how the levels will be integrated with existing structures. It’s also important to consider the overall layout, access points, and any local building codes or regulations that may apply. Clarifying these details helps ensure the finished deck meets both functional needs and aesthetic preferences, providing a durable and attractive enhancement to the property.

Multi Level Deck Installation Questions
What is a multi-level deck? A multi-level deck features two or more connected platforms at different heights, adding visual interest and functional space to outdoor areas.
What types of projects are suitable for multi-level decks? They are ideal for creating distinct zones, such as dining and lounging areas, or adapting to uneven terrain on a property.
What materials are commonly used for multi-level decks? Common options include pressure-treated wood, composite decking, and cedar, chosen for durability and appearance.
What should property owners consider before installing a multi-level deck? It's important to evaluate site topography, access points, and desired design features to ensure proper integration with the property.
